Pastel Wedding Dresses for 2013

Color is in! And wedding designers have chosen the next best thing to the pure white traditional color for the wedding dresses – Pastels! Bridal collections for 2013 saw beautiful pastel colored wedding gowns. While blue continued to be the flavor of the season, other colors that made their mark were pink (not so surprisingly), green and yellow.

Here are some beautiful, delicately colored wedding dresses for modern brides:

Isaac Mizrahi Pastel Pink Wedding Dress
Isaac Mizrahi Pastel Pink Wedding Dress

A strapless pale pink wedding gown by Isaac Mizrahi with a full skirt and a black sash to color block the pink.

Oscar De La Renta Blue Crochet Overlay Wedding Dress
Blue Crochet Overlay Wedding Dress by Oscar De La Renta

Add pastel blue to your wedding dress without taking all of the white by doing it ‘De la Renta’ style! The white crochet overlay over a light blue wedding dress beneath is sure to be loved by all brides who dream in color.

Pastel Yellow Wedding Dress by Terry Fox
Pastel Yellow Wedding Dress by Terry Fox

Shimmery organza makes the pastel yellow dress by Terry Fox look festive and special enough for the Bride to stand out in her wedding dress on her special day. The tulle overlay makes sure you do not entirely drift from the traditional wedding style.

Pastel Wedding Dresses by Vera Wang
Pastel Wedding Dresses by Vera Wang

Vera Wang adds ruffles and bows to her pale colored wedding dresses for this collection to make them extra feminine and breezy.

Pastel Green Wedding Dress by Terry Fox
Pastel Green Wedding Dress by Terry Fox

Another beautiful wedding gown by Terry Fox, this time in pale green organza and with an overlay of tulle for a touch of the classic bridal dress style.

Pastel Blue Full Skirt Wedding Dress by Oscar De La Renta
Pastel Blue Full Skirt Wedding Dress by Oscar De La Renta

Oscar De La Renta never fails to render dreamy, romantic creations. In another romantic blue wedding dress from his collection, the skirt is full and there is oodles of romantic tulle in the same color in the train.
